Marvel What Alexa Chung Smells Like? We’ve Bought the Reply

Trend icon Alexa Chung has lengthy been one in all our favourite trendsetters, so naturally, we’re at all times interested in what she’s carrying—particularly with regards to magnificence. Fortunate for us, she just lately revealed her signature scent to The Reduce. Whereas many people Beauty editors are responsible of stocking our vanities with numerous perfumes and swapping out our signature scent seasonally, Chung retains it refreshingly easy, naming only one as her all-time favourite.

When requested to call her “signature scent,” she revealed, “Régime des Fleurs. It’s a fragrance made in collaboration with my friend Christopher Niquet. It’s called Rock River Melody and it’s named after his pony from when he was a kid, which is a really extra name to give a horse.” (True.) Thankfully for us, she described its distinctive scent as properly. “It sort of smells like leather, but it’s also feminine and warm. It has a summer vibe to it but not too floral and pretty,” she mentioned.

Perfumer and Régime des Fleurs founder Alia Raza has her personal vivid description: “Christopher and I worked together to capture that feeling of striking out into the outdoors for the first time after a long winter. Crisp spring mornings with young leaves on trees and flowers just beginning to bud. We envisioned the magic of the ancient forest of Fontainebleau outside of Paris whose vistas have been captured by artists and inhabited by French aristocracy for a millennium.”

For many who choose a breakdown of perfume notes, the scent opens with contemporary, inexperienced hedera ivy and bergamot, transitions into earthy patchouli and delicate florals like rose and finishes heat and woody with sandalwood, cedar and musk. Should you love an earthy, outdoors-inspired perfume, this one may simply be value including to your assortment—particularly with Chung’s seal of approval.
